Eng sync notes — Brambleworth loyalty ledger. Reconciliation job flagged 412 mismatched point balances after last week's migration; all traced to double-applied promo multipliers. Correction script drafted and tested on the Quillhaven staging copy. Agreed to run it during Sunday's low-traffic window, with a full audit snapshot before and after. Remediation is owned by the engineer named below.

account owner for bawip-tahag: Raleth Quenok

## Auth

Heads up: Spindlewick partitions the `events` table by month, so queries and migrations hit partition-aware endpoints rather than the raw database. That means even read-only jobs go through the Lattice API, which handles routing to the right monthly partition for you. Don't hand-roll partition names — they shift on the first of each month and you'll miss the cutover. All Lattice calls need a service credential in the request header; for local dev, use the one below.

gateway credential: kto23_LX9A4ys6i4nzHtpOLNLodKK

# Vendored fonts for the Quillmark rendering module.
#
# We vendor the three display faces from the Tessencourt foundry rather than
# fetching them at build time, because the release pipeline for Quillmark must
# be fully reproducible offline. Each font file is checksummed at import and
# re-verified during packaging; a mismatch should block the release. When
# bumping a font version, update the glyph-cache sizing below so rasterization
# stays within the frame budget. The constants governing cache and fallback
# behavior are as follows.

tuning table, fawip-fahag:
WEIGHTS = {
    "novwyn": 452,
    "casdor": 675,
}

## Further Reading

Plugins for Calqwright must evaluate user-supplied formulas inside the Hexcell sandbox. Direct interpreter access is blocked; all calls route through the capability shim. Escape attempts trip the runtime and disable your plugin. Review the sandbox contract, allowed builtins, and resource limits before submitting. The full sandboxing guide lives on our internal wiki.

runbook for kajof-bahif: https://sentry.ferranet.local/merge_requests/repo/projects/view/81769af030f7d6d2